How to start Gym by UnluckyAsk0 in PCOS

[–]Current_Pressure_344 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Totally with you.  Very uncoordinated and physically weak.  Am still overweight but the gym and physical fitness has helped so much in all areas.

So I’d start walking or running at home.  They have tons of apps and systems in place if you are interested in doing free weights at home.

For the gym I’d suggest sticking with machines until you feel comfortable only because they have guides and they show you what muscles you’re working.  

Are there specific areas you want to target?  Some gyms also have classes if you feel more comfortable there.

Not sure what your budget is but I got into Orangetheory pretty early on in my fitness journey. OTF was amazing in helping me find the right form with free weights and build up my cardio.  Couldn’t afford it after a few months, but it set me in a positive path.

Ps: do not sign a contract with the gym until you’ve at least tried the gym and been okay with the ambience and you feel comfortable there.  Different gyms will feel differently.

A or B? by Fit_Needleworker468 in slp

[–]Current_Pressure_344 3 points4 points  (0 children)

So you make 87k in a 10 month versus 85 over 12 months.

Over the summer you still have a chance to vacation or earn other income on top of your 87

Prek is tough because your numbers  will grow as kids always turn three so higher eval numbers.

Shorter hours but might be tougher work life balance near the end of the school year.

You have to think of the job b as 8-6 because of th commute.  

That said the lower caseload might be really nice and there’s a lot to be said for other SLP companions.   

I’d say pick what fits in your life better. Like are you a morning person that needs to get things done before work (drop off kid, go to the gym, walk the dog, etc). Or do you prefer to do things after work.
